Description Harlan Stenn 2017-02-19 02:26:31 UTC
For a while now (mponths, maybe a year), every prebuilt package version of ipmitool I've tried coredumps when I try and access a remote IPMI port with -I lanplus.

This happens with ipmitool-1.8.17_1.

If I build the package from source it works just fine.

The base OS is up-to-date:

 10.3-RELEASE-p11 FreeBSD 10.3-RELEASE-p11 #0: Mon Oct 24 18:49:24 UTC 2016     root@amd64-builder.daemonology.net:/usr/obj/usr/src/sys/GENERIC  amd64
